Gao Tianyuan was gone. He was Kaido now.

As someone who had read countless web novels, his first reaction to realizing he had transmigrated into Kaido's body was pure excitement. After all, he had been at the bottom of society in his previous life. The chance to live a new life in a world he already knew, and to start as a powerful figure like Kaido of the Beasts, was something to celebrate.

But his excitement didn't last long.

He searched through Kaido's memories and used his own knowledge of the world to confirm his situation. The current timeline was likely right at the beginning of the main story. He couldn't find Monkey D. Luffy's name on any bounty posters from the East Blue, and the Warlord Crocodile was still active. This meant Luffy had probably just set sail and was still making his way through the weakest of the four seas.

This gave him, at most, three years. Three years until the prophesied Joy Boy arrived, and he would be defeated and removed from the world stage.

That was completely unacceptable.

Could he prevent it? Kaido thought about it for a long time but couldn't find a solution.

First, his conflict with Luffy was almost guaranteed. Even though they had never met, they were destined to become enemies. This was not just because Kaido was occupying Wano Country, but also because he possessed one of the red Road Poneglyphs—a crucial piece of the map Luffy needed to become the Pirate King.

So, did he have the confidence to defeat Luffy in a direct fight?

Sadly, the answer was no. Even though he had completely merged with Kaido and inherited all his power and memories, he couldn't stop thinking about the Nika Fruit. The ridiculous abilities and the main character's endless resilience gave him no confidence that he could win. Who knew if the world would suddenly introduce a new power-up for the hero just as he was about to lose? If that happened, all he could do was accept his fate.

What about getting rid of Luffy before he became a threat? It sounded like a good idea, but Kaido quickly gave up on it. If he tried that, he would only die faster. His enemies wouldn't just be the Straw Hat crew. He would have to face the Red Hair Pirates, the Revolutionary Army, the Whitebeard Pirates, the Marine Hero Garp, and the Dark King Rayleigh.

Besides, his pride as a transmigrator and as one of the Four Emperors wouldn't allow him to do something so cowardly.

The most despairing part was that he was already at the peak. As the World's Strongest Creature and a Yonko of the New World, Kaido's strength—his body, his Haki, his Devil Fruit—had already reached the limits of what was possible in this world. It would be incredibly difficult for him to get any stronger through normal training.

It seemed hopeless. Was he really just a stepping stone for Luffy's rise to power?

Just as Kaido felt his future was bleak, a spark of inspiration hit him. If the powers of the One Piece world couldn't defeat the chosen one, Luffy, then what about power from a different world?

This idea came from his life before he transmigrated. He had been an ordinary office worker on Earth who once believed that money was the most important thing in life. But after a difficult year that changed everyone's lives, his priorities shifted. Health became more important than wealth.

As an office worker, he didn't have the time, money, or energy for intense exercise. So, he looked for gentler methods he could practice at home, which led him to some mystical Taoist Qi cultivation techniques he found online. He never expected them to actually work, and back on Earth, they didn't.

But things were different now. Transmigration itself was impossible, yet here he was. With no other way to face his destiny, he decided it wouldn't hurt to try those old cultivation methods again. It was a desperate move, but it was that desperation that brought him a new sense of hope.

It worked. He had actually succeeded.

The cultivation method was called the "Greater and Lesser Heavenly Cycle Self-Rotation Method." It was a common and basic Taoist technique he had found online, so the instructions were very detailed. This method was completely different from the cultivation in fantasy novels, which involved stages like Qi Refining and Foundation Establishment, because the real world had no spiritual energy. Perhaps that was exactly why it could work in the world of One Piece, which also seemed to lack spiritual energy.

The method was divided into three advancements: Refining Essence to Transform Qi, Refining Qi to Transform Spirit, and Refining Spirit to Return to Void.

The 'essence' wasn't a magical substance. It was the energy an ordinary person's body already possessed—energy from food, water, air, and sunlight. 'Refining Essence to Transform Qi' involved circulating this energy through the body's 'Lesser Heavenly Cycle' to refine it into an innate life force, or 'Qi.' This 'Qi' could strengthen the body, heal illnesses, and build a solid foundation.

'Refining Qi to Transform Spirit' involved a more advanced circulation, the 'Greater Heavenly Cycle.' This stage combined the 'Qi' he had cultivated with his 'spirit'—his mind, will, and soul. The goal was to strengthen his mental and spiritual power.

Finally, 'Refining Spirit to Return to Void' was the ultimate goal, where essence, qi, and spirit were cultivated together. When the cycles ran automatically, the cultivator would reach a state of perfect harmony, becoming what people in his old world called an Immortal.

Of course, Kaido wasn't trying to become an immortal. He just wanted to find a way to defeat this world's chosen one, the user of the Nika Fruit.

So, for the past three months, while he familiarized himself with his new body's power, he also practiced this cultivation method. The results were astounding.

Maybe it was because his soul had merged with Kaido's, or because Kaido's body was already incredibly powerful. Or perhaps Haki and Devil Fruit abilities were a type of energy that could be cultivated. Whatever the reason, when he tried for the first time, he easily entered the 'Refining Essence to Transform Qi' stage. He felt the legendary 'Qi sense' and could feel the flow of life force within his body.

The effects were obvious. First, while his human form hadn't changed much, his azure dragon form had transformed dramatically. It seemed to grow larger and stronger every day.

Second, he felt his body getting younger. The original Kaido was 57 years old, and the problems of aging were beginning to affect him. But now, nourished by 'Qi,' his old battle injuries were slowly healing. The most noticeable change was the scar on his abdomen, left by Kozuki Oden's Paradise Totsuka attack. The deep, aching pain from that wound was finally starting to fade.

Finally, he felt a change in his Haki. It was no longer just a sharp, fierce force. After being refined by his cultivation, it felt more natural, more profound. He could use his Haki more easily, and it seemed to have a much stronger suppressing effect on Devil Fruit users.

These changes gave him the confidence he needed to face the future.

"Hmph, I don't care if you're the chosen one, the protagonist, or the reincarnation of Joy Boy," Kaido thought to himself. "Now that I am Kaido, I have a power that doesn't belong to this world. There can only be one main character here, and that's me!"

"Worororo..."

With a hearty laugh, Kaido transformed into his massive dragon form. He stepped onto clouds of flame and flew towards Wano Country.
